Monosaccharides are the smallest kinds of sugar, also called a simple sugar (e.g. glucose).

When two simple sugar molecules join together they form a complex sugar called disaccharides (e.g. sucrose or maltose). If many simple sugars join together, a large molecule is formed called a polysaccharide (e.g. starch or glycogen).

Monosaccharides are the most basic form of sugar and can not be broken down into a smaller form. They are usually colorless, water-soluble, and crystalline solids. Examples of monosaccharides include glucose and fructose.
